01-24-2011, 07:29 PM
Cutler seems like an odd duck. It's like he has almost no social skills. There is an expectation among players and fans alike to play hurt, and the fact that he did not seem obviously hobbled by the injury (he could at least move around on the leg) is always going to call into question his toughness and commitment. I also recall Hines Ward implicitly questioning Roethlisberger's toughness awhile back when he didn't play with a head injury. We like tough, gritty players and want them to gut it out through pain and injury, especially in big games.

That said, I sort of like professional athletes who don't make commercials (reeaaallly sick of seeing Peyton Manning) or tweet or promote themselves on "reality" shows or whatever. He's sort of a contrarian to the overwhelming noisy blitz and glitz of the contemporary NFL media complex and I gotta say I like that about him.
